Output 0024fc45c6855954074557cb8811999b088aa9bb87bd7cf977b1204432fc9713:69

value
578810041
script pubkey
OP_0 OP_PUSHBYTES_20 2e373b5ae080a6791c69c39f7e4a1a5187ee463a
address
bc1q9cmnkkhqszn8j8rfcw0hujs62xr7u336c0sn5f
transaction
0024fc45c6855954074557cb8811999b088aa9bb87bd7cf977b1204432fc9713
spent
true